Pataki won't rule out 2012 presidential bid
George Pataki has ruled out a Senate run, but he's leaving his options open on a bid for the White House.

In an interview with The Hill, the former New York governor said, "I love the private sector ... There are going to be a lot of good people running and my focus is on 2010."

Pataki, 64, declined to rule out a presidential run, noting that he initially said he wouldn't run for a third term as governor and then subsequently changed his mind.

"I've learned never to say never," said Pataki, who toyed with the idea of running for president in 2008.
